How they compare
Solomon Islands currently reports 103,683 against 95,872 in Slovenia, a difference of 7,811.
That makes Solomon Islands's figure about 1.1 times Slovenia's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 74 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Slovenia ahead.
Slovenia ranks 155th and Solomon Islands ranks 153rd of 236 countries.
Across the 8 decades both report, Slovenia averaged higher in 7 and Solomon Islands in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Slovenia | Solomon Islands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 153,570 | 22,328 | 131,242 | Slovenia |
| 1960s | 143,184 | 29,134 | 114,049 | Slovenia |
| 1970s | 144,227 | 38,926 | 105,301 | Slovenia |
| 1980s | 140,376 | 50,171 | 90,204 | Slovenia |
| 1990s | 105,488 | 64,489 | 40,999 | Slovenia |
| 2000s | 91,838 | 75,810 | 16,028 | Slovenia |
| 2010s | 106,706 | 93,643 | 13,063 | Slovenia |
| 2020s | 98,682 | 103,001 | 4,320 | Solomon Islands |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
